JUDDMONTE SCOOPS TWO TBA AWARDS
Taken from the Racing Post website
Six 2009 Thoroughbred Breeders' Association award winners have been revealed, acknowledging achievements by British breeders and studs throughout the year.
Khalid Abdullah's Juddmonte Farms landed two of the TBA's most prestigious prizes – the Queen’s Silver Cup for being the leading British-based breeder by Flat earnings, and the BBA Silver Cigar Box for its resident OASIS DREAM being the leading British-based stallion by Flat earnings.
Juddmonte secured the Queen’s Silver Cup for the second year in a row and for the sixth time since 2000. The operation bred 61 winners of 95 races who accrued £2,342,000 in prize-money, including Group 1 victories for Midday in the Nassau Stakes, Twice Over in the Champion Stakes and Special Duty in the Cheveley Park Stakes.
Progeny by OASIS DREAM, who stands at Abdullah’s Banstead Manor Stud, earned £2.86 million, leading to their sire winning the BBA Silver Cigar Box.
